Transaction 95dce2005f12afdbd41035300955f4e0679e415027d7dd6efa387e9dc27e6436
1 Input
1 Output
-
95dce2005f12afdbd41035300955f4e0679e415027d7dd6efa387e9dc27e6436:0
- value
- 10692259
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3084cb7c60561aebadbf429f57937f5ea350a2ad OP_EQUAL
- address
- 367ZSVzcCrY753dAoarg6Awz8ixgrDjBZ6